Urban Engineers is seeking qualified individuals in Pennsylvania, including Philadelphia, Pittsburgh, Erie, Allentown, Scranton, Mechanicsburg, State College, and Williamsport, to join the Construction Management Department as Transportation Construction Managers (TCM-1 and TCM-2) for highway construction projects. Details about pay, sign-on bonus, and benefits are provided below.

This position will be responsible for:

  • Inspecting highways and bridges to ensure construction conforms with plans and specifications.
  • Inspecting and documenting daily field activities performed by the contractor, acting as a client representative.
  • Facilitating daily communication between the inspection team, contractor, and client.
  • Managing construction inspection staff and projects.
  • Additional tasks may include: preparing Project Site Activity (PSA) reports, using electronic tablets and computers, processing payments, issuing work authorizations and work orders, and monitoring project schedules.

Job Requirements:

  • Previous experience as a TCIS on PennDOT projects, or at least 8 years of transportation highway construction inspection supervisor/management experience, or 6 years of transportation, highway, or bridge construction inspection experience.
  • Must have certifications: NICET Level IV (Highway Construction), NECEPT Asphalt, and NECEPT/PennDOT Concrete.
  • A B.S. Degree in Civil Engineering or a Professional Engineer (PE) license can substitute for four years of experience.
  • A PE license can substitute for a NICET certification.

Additional Requirements:

  • PennDOT ECMS v3 and PPCC experience preferred.
  • Basic computer skills for reviewing construction drawings/specifications and documentation.
  • Ability to navigate construction sites in various terrains and weather conditions.
  • Work hours may include day, night shifts, and weekends.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Must own a vehicle and have a valid driver’s license; mileage reimbursement provided.
